Temperature evolution of polarization versus electric field of (Ba 0.4Sr 0.6)TiO 3 and (Ba 0.9Sr 0.1)TiO 3 ceramics was investigated. Polarization characteristics of (Ba 0.9Sr 0.1)TiO 3 belong to ferroelectrics with diffuse phase transition (DPT), while the ones of (Ba 0.4Sr 0.6)TiO 3 are rather different. (Ba 0.4Sr 0.6)TiO 3 ceramics display very soft ferroelectricity and extremely high dielectric tunability. The long-range ferroelectric ordering in (Ba 0.4Sr 0.6)TiO 3 ceramics disappears completely below temperature T m of maximum dielectric permittivity ε m, which is different from normal DPT ferroelectrics. The special ferroelectric behavior is hypothesized to be attributed to random arrangements of the distorted TiO 6 octahedra.
